| Packing
|
- •
Pack your luggage the night before
in case of being late for your flight.
-
•
Place an identification strip
around your cases.
- •
If you are taking some gifts, it
is advisable not to pack them in
gift wrappers as they will be unpacked
at the time of screening.
-
•
The fewer luggages, the fewer
worries.
-
Verify
with the airline’s allowed
baggage allowances ensure that
your luggage does not exceed that
level.

| Baggage
|
- Check
with the airline you are traveling
with on the stipulated baggage allowances.
- Ensure
that your hand baggage allowance
does not exceed the level enforced
by the airline you are traveling
with. This ensures unnecessary embarrassment
at the check-in desk, having to
move luggage from your hand baggage
to your suitcase.

| Jetlag
|
- Try
to drink plenty of water whilst
on the aircraft as this helps to
counter dehydration.
- Check
in flight magazines, for gentle
exercises to do whilst on board
to stop stiffness and tiredness
of joints.
- Cleanse
and moisturize skin regularly whilst
on board again to counter dehydration.
- Eat
a light meal onboard as easier to
digest, avoid excessive carbohydrates
and fats.
